Welcome and if I could give one piece of sound advice, it would be to be smart and don't rest on your memory of Atkins: re-read the red Atkins book and read all the posts on Induction in this forum. I spent a few weeks not being very productive before I got myself on track with a clean Induction (I'm small-brained I guess lol). Use fitday.com as a smart tool to plan your meals and track them. Also, join the exercise challenges, they are motivating and you get results.
